a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Joseph Hunkeler <jhunkeler@gmail.com>2026-04-22 11:34:39 -0400
committerJoseph Hunkeler <jhunkeler@gmail.com>2026-04-22 11:34:39 -0400
commit49dd77f16f2575dc8b9e8979e4692d0d449abef3 (patch)
tree6bb0e2cfcf2627a2da75bc8515cc484b31cb4dff
parent5c51880cf2c39c7d4c16a5af51a3502f6cdbcac5 (diff)
downloadstasis-49dd77f16f2575dc8b9e8979e4692d0d449abef3.tar.gz
indexer_readmes: consolidate asprintf error condition handling
-rw-r--r--src/cli/stasis_indexer/readmes.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/cli/stasis_indexer/readmes.c b/src/cli/stasis_indexer/readmes.c
index 91c936f..4081485 100644
--- a/src/cli/stasis_indexer/readmes.c
+++ b/src/cli/stasis_indexer/readmes.c
@@ -63,13 +63,13 @@ int indexer_readmes(struct Delivery **ctx, const size_t nelem) {
fprintf(indexfp, " - Receipt: [STASIS input file](%s)\n", conf_name_relative);
char *pattern = NULL;
- asprintf(&pattern, "*%s*%s*",
+ if (asprintf(&pattern, "*%s*%s*",
latest_deliveries[i]->info.build_number,
- strstr((*ctx)->rules.release_fmt, "%p") ? latest_deliveries[i]->meta.python_compact : "" );
- if (!pattern) {
+ strstr((*ctx)->rules.release_fmt, "%p") ? latest_deliveries[i]->meta.python_compact : "" ) < 0) {
SYSERROR("%s", "Unable to allocate bytes for pattern");
return -1;
}
+
struct StrList *docker_images = get_docker_images(latest_deliveries[i], pattern);
if (docker_images
&& strlist_count(docker_images)